Що таке рендер: основи, принципи та його значення у дизайні

Що таке рендер: основи, принципи та його значення у дизайні Цікаве

Що таке рендер: Основи та сутність поняття

Що таке рендер? Це питання є фундаментальним для розуміння процесів комп’ютерної графіки та створення візуального контенту. Термін “рендер” походить від англійського “rendering”, що буквально означає “відтворення”, “відображення” або “візуалізацію”. У більш широкому сенсі, рендеринг — це процес перетворення тривимірної (3D) моделі в двовимірне (2D) зображення.

Технічні аспекти рендерингу

Основні етапи рендерингу:

  • Збір даних: на етапі підготовки збираються всі необхідні елементи: 3D моделі, світло, текстури і матеріали.
  • Калькуляція освітлення: враховуються джерела світла, призначених для сцени, щоб підрахувати як світло взаємодіє з об’єктами.
  • Процес рендерингу: основний етап, під час якого комп’ютер обчислює і створює 2D зображення з 3D сцен.
  • Пост-обробка: включає налагодження кольору, додавання ефектів тощо для покращення фінального зображення.

Методи рендерингу

Є кілька популярних методів рендерингу, які відрізняються в основному швидкістю та якістю зображення:

  1. Растровий рендеринг: дуже швидкий, використовується в реальному часі для відеоігор і інтерактивних застосунків. Однак якість зображення може бути обмежена.
  2. Трасування променів (Ray tracing): дає дуже реалістичні результати, але потребує більше часу на розрахунки. Зарекомендувало себе в кіноіндустрії.
  3. Рендеринг на основі фізики (Physically-Based Rendering – PBR): забезпечує фізично правдоподібне відображення матеріалів за рахунок використання реальних фізичних параметрів.
  4. Глобальне освітлення (Global Illumination): техніка, яка розраховує як пряме, так і непряме освітлення для досягнення високої якості освітлення сцен.

Види рендерингу

Розмежуємо рендеринг на кілька основних типів:

Читайте також:  Що таке числівники: визначення та приклади в українській мові
Тип рендерингу Опис
Стаціонарний рендеринг (Off-line) Використовується для створення високоякісних зображень, де час обробки не є критичним.
Рендеринг в реальному часі (Real-time) Використовується в інтерактивних середовищах, таких як ігри, де зображення повинно бути створене миттєво.
Гібридний рендеринг Поєднує в собі переваги як реального часу, так і стаціонарного рендерингу для оптимізації продуктивності та якості.

Застосування рендерингу в різних галузях

Технологія рендерингу знаходить застосування в багатьох галузях. Ось кілька прикладів цікавих варіантів використання:

Кіноіндустрія

За допомогою рендерингу кіностудії створюють вражаючі візуальні ефекти, сцени з великим рівнем деталізації і реалізму. Використання рендерингу дозволяє відтворювати неймовірні фізичні місця, яке інакше було б неможливо зняти.

Віртуальна реальність (VR) та доповнена реальність (AR)

Реалізація реального рендерингу дозволяє отримати швидкі та натуралістичні зображення, що є критичним для створення занурюючого досвіду в межах VR/AR.

Архітектурна візуалізація

Рендеринг дозволяє архітекторам та дизайнерам візуалізувати проекти будівель, інтер’єрів та ландшафтів ще до їхньої реалізації.

Відеоігри

Рендеринг в реальному часі є основою для роботи більшості сучасних комп’ютерних ігор, де крок за кроком створюється і оновлюється графіка, щоб підтримувати геймплей.

Медична візуалізація

У медицині рендеринг використовується для створення 3D образів з використанням даних комп’ютерної томографії та магнітного резонансу, що дозволяє хірургам краще розуміти внутрішні структури організму.

Програмне забезпечення для рендерингу

На ринку є безліч варіантів програмного забезпечення для рендерингу, кожне з яких має свої плюси і мінуси:

  • V-Ray: потужний інструмент для створення фотореалістичних зображень, використовується в архітектурній візуалізації та кінематографі.
  • Blender: відкритий і безкоштовний програмний продукт, що дозволяє виконувати всі етапи моделювання і рендерингу.
  • Unreal Engine: популярний ігровий рушій, який має розвинену систему рендерингу для реалізації реалістичних і вражаючих сцен в реальному часі.
  • Autodesk Maya: комплексна програма для 3D моделювання, анімації, і, звичайно, рендерингу.
Читайте також:  Які 8 релігій володарюють у світі: дізнайтеся ключові вірування

Висновок

Розуміння, що таке рендер, суттєво розширює уявлення про можливості сучасних технологій створення графічного та візуального контенту. Це критична частина робочих процесів в широкому спектрі галузей, які стосуються візуалізації. Незалежно від того, чи мова йде про кінематограф, відеоігри, архітектурну візуалізацію чи медицину, рендеринг допомагає перетворювати концептуальні ідеї в остаточні, привабливі візуальні образи.

Оцініть статтю